520 _aThis powerhouse author team brings their award-winning teaching styles, research, and professional consulting experience to help students' better understand and use Organizational Behavior to flourish both professionally and personally. Kinicki/Fugate, Organizational Behavior , 1e uses a conversational writing style with a visually engaging layout to appeal to todays student. This provides a "chunking" of the content and introduces students to what they are about to learn through a "Major Question/Bigger Picture." To bring the concepts through to application, Kinicki/Fugate 1e employs a problem-solving approach. This is presented through the "Problem-Solving Applications" (30 total boxed items appearing throughout each chapter) that present a business situation. Students work through these scenarios in the "Your Call" feature--a three-step problem solving approach. These are designed to help students apply concepts and strengthen their problem-solving skills. The self-assessments are integrated in the content as well as assignable in Connect through the Interactive Application Self-Assessment tool. These have been hand picked and researched by the author team to ensure quality and research-based assessments. With this Self-Assessment tool, students will be able to immediately assess personal characteristics related to Organizational Behavior concepts being discussed in class.
